Azerbaijan Halts Training Flights After Fighter Jet Crash
Azerbaijan's Air Force has suspended training flights following the crash of a MiG-29 jet. This was reported to RIA Novosti by the press service of Azerbaijan's Ministry of Defense.
Yesterday, the Ministry of Defense announced that the MiG-29 had crashed into the sea. Azerbaijani Minval.az has recently reported that the location of the aircraft has been identified. It will soon be recovered from the sea. However, it has been noted that there is currently no new information regarding the search for the pilot.
